Mumbai Horror: Delivery Boy Kills 17-Year-Old Girlfriend, Dumps Body on Hill (X)
Mumbai: The Samta Nagar Police have arrested a 22-year-old man for allegedly murdering his 17-year-old girlfriend and dumping her body in a hilly area of Kandivali in north Mumbai, a police official said.
A 22-year-old man was arrested in Mumbai for allegedly murdering his girlfriend in a forested area near the Lovegarh locality on the outskirts of Sanjay Gandhi National Park (SGNP) at Kandivali East.
The accused, who is identified as 22-year-old Suraj Waghmare, and the 17-year-old girl were in a relationship but he objected to her interactions with other men, the police said.
The police said that the victim's body was discovered by local residents on Friday, who immediately alerted the authorities.
The most important clue in this sensational murder was a college question paper found near the body, which led the police directly to the identity of the deceased and then to her accused. The accused himself pretended to be searching for the missing student (girlfriend) and joined the search with her father, so that no one would suspect him.
On Friday morning, passersby discovered the student's body, drenched in blood, in the Damu Nagar Lavdongar hill area. She had suffered multiple stab wounds to her neck.
On Friday, police were informed about a girl, aged 16 to 18, being found dead in the forest.
Upon arriving at the scene, the police found a notebook containing her college question paper. Based on this clue, the police arrived at the victim's college in Kandivali. They learned that a student had been missing since Thursday. The police then went to the missing student's home in Kandivali and confirmed her identity by showing her photo to her family.
An official said that the investigation revealed that the student was in a relationship with her 22-year-old boyfriend, Suraj Waghmare, who works as a delivery boy. The family told the police that their daughter had gone to college on Thursday but did not return.
Based on technical evidence, call details, and mobile location, Samta Nagar police detained Suraj. He initially claimed innocence, but broke down during interrogation. Suraj admitted that he was suspicious of his girlfriend's interactions with friends and that she was constantly pressuring him to marry her, even though he did not want to marry her yet. This led him to plot the murder.
According to the police investigation, Suraj invited the girl to meet him at Love Dongar Hill in Damu Nagar on Thursday. They initially ate biryani and spent several hours together. Around 3 pm, the accused stabbed his girlfriend multiple times in the neck with a sharp knife, killing her. He then switched off her mobile phone, took her bag, and returned to his home in Lahu Ji Chawl in Damu Nagar. In the evening, he visited her family and pretended to be innocent.
DCP Gajanan Rajmane stated that the Samta Nagar police arrested the accused and presented him in court, where he was remanded to police custody. In this case, a simple questionnaire became a clue for the police, unraveling the entire murder mystery within a few hours.
